Accessibility:
Meyersdal benefits from excellent connectivity, strategically positioned along the R59 corridor and providing seamless access to major highways such as the N12 and N3. This prime location allows businesses in the area to efficiently transport goods and services across Gauteng, including Johannesburg and Ekurhuleni, while also facilitating quick access to OR Tambo International Airport and key freight terminals.

Historical Context:
Originally a residential suburb, Meyersdal has seen significant commercial and industrial expansion in recent years. The demand for strategically located business premises has led to the development of modern business parks and industrial facilities, positioning Meyersdal as a key player in Alberton's economic landscape. Its evolution from a purely residential area to a mixed-use hub has enhanced its appeal to investors and business owners alike.

Amenities and Infrastructure:
Meyersdal is home to a range of business-supporting amenities, including banking institutions, retail centers, and corporate office spaces. Nearby commercial hubs, such as Meyersdal Mall and Meyersdal Office Park, provide essential services for businesses operating in the area. Additionally, the presence of fitness centers, restaurants, and luxury residential estates makes it an appealing location for professionals working in the district.
Transportation:
The industrial and commercial zones of Meyersdal benefit from easy access to the R59 highway, which connects businesses to the broader Gauteng region. The N12 and N3 highways further enhance logistics capabilities, facilitating quick transport between Johannesburg, Pretoria, and surrounding industrial nodes. Public transport options, including minibus taxis and nearby train stations, support workforce mobility, ensuring employees can conveniently commute to and from the area.
